Pricing of First LTE-Equipped Microsoft (MSFT) Surface Tablet Revealed
Microsoft's (Nasdaq: MSFT) Surface 2 pricing on AT&T's (NYSE: T) 4G LTE network is out and the initial level seems fair.
According to Windows Phone Central, the 64-GB Surface 2 will price at $679, which will be about $130 more than the non-LTE Surface 2 with the same memory. No word on whether that price will come down with tie-ins or a new, two-year contract commitment.
This will be the first Surface tablet from Microsoft with LTE capability, marking a stronger effort by the company for broader global appeal of its hardware.
